A side-by-side view of publicly reported data for these two schools.

Friendship PCS - Blow Pierce Elementary
Two Rivers PCS - Young ES
  • Friendship PCS - Blow Pierce Elementary reported a higher students per counselor than Two Rivers PCS - Young ES (476:1 vs. 144.5:1).
  • Friendship PCS - Blow Pierce Elementary reported a higher chronically absent students than Two Rivers PCS - Young ES (113 vs. 85).
  • Two Rivers PCS - Young ES reported a higher violent incidents than Friendship PCS - Blow Pierce Elementary (2 vs. 0).
  • Source Data Limit: 6 metrics are directly comparable between the two schools.
